Target data

Function

Rho GTPase-activating protein (GAP) (PubMed:19673492, PubMed:28894085). Binds several acidic phospholipids which inhibits the Rho GAP activity to promote the Rac GAP activity (PubMed:19673492). This binding is inhibited by phosphorylation by PRKCA (PubMed:19673492). Involved in cell differentiation as well as cell adhesion and migration, plays an important role in retinal tissue morphogenesis, neural tube fusion, midline fusion of the cerebral hemispheres and mammary gland branching morphogenesis (By similarity). Transduces signals from p21-ras to the nucleus, acting via the ras GTPase-activating protein (GAP) (By similarity). Transduces SRC-dependent signals from cell-surface adhesion molecules, such as laminin, to promote neurite outgrowth. Regulates axon outgrowth, guidance and fasciculation (By similarity). Modulates Rho GTPase-dependent F-actin polymerization, organization and assembly, is involved in polarized cell migration and in the positive regulation of ciliogenesis and cilia elongation (By similarity). During mammary gland development, is required in both the epithelial and stromal compartments for ductal outgrowth (By similarity). Represses transcription of the glucocorticoid receptor by binding to the cis-acting regulatory sequence 5'-GAGAAAAGAAACTGGAGAAACTC-3'; this function is however unclear and would need additional experimental evidences (PubMed:1894621).

Supplementary info

This supplementary information is collated from multiple sources and compiled automatically.
Activity summary

GRLF1 also known as Glucocorticoid Receptor DNA Binding Factor 1 is a protein with a mass of approximately 196 kDa. This protein plays a role in gene regulation by interacting with DNA binding sites associated with glucocorticoid receptors. GRLF1 is widely expressed in various tissues but shows a higher expression level in the brain. It functions in stabilizing the linkage between glucocorticoid receptors and chromatin facilitating important transcriptional processes.

Biological function summary

GRLF1 interacts with nuclear receptors to regulate gene transcription and modulates cellular responses to glucocorticoids. It serves as a co-factor aiding in the assembly of transcriptional complexes needed for hormonal regulation. By forming complexes with other transcription factors GRLF1 influences cellular differentiation and immune response. Its involvement in the regulation of gene expression suggests a significant impact on cell signaling and homeostatic balance.

Pathways

GRLF1 contributes to the glucocorticoid signaling pathway and the MAPK/ERK pathway. In the glucocorticoid pathway it cooperates with the GR protein family to adapt cellular responses to stress and inflammation. Within the MAPK/ERK pathway GRLF1 assists in regulating cell growth and differentiation by interacting with proteins like ERK1/2 impacting cell cycle progression.

Associated diseases and disorders

Researchers link GRLF1 to neurological disorders and inflammatory conditions. In neurodegenerative diseases altered GRLF1 function may affect neuronal survival and cognitive function. Its dysregulation can also contribute to autoimmune disorders where the inflammatory response becomes imbalanced. Through these connections GRLF1 interacts with proteins such as GR and NF-kB influencing both normal physiology and pathological states.
